Remains

//ɹɪˈmeɪnz// noun, verb

Definitions

Noun
  1. 1
    The body or any of its matter that are left after a person (or any organism) dies; a corpse. plural, plural-only

    "They buried the remains of their longtime friend in the town cemetery."

  2. 2
    plural of remain form-of, plural, rare
  3. 3
    the dead body of a human being wordnet
  4. 4
    Historical or archaeological relics. plural, plural-only
  5. 5
    a relic that has been excavated from the soil wordnet
Show 3 more definitions
  1. 6
    The extant writings of a deceased person. plural, plural-only

    "To his great intellectual powers his published remains bear abundant witness."

  2. 7
    any object that is left unused or still extant wordnet
  3. 8
    All that is left of the stock of some things; remnants. plural, plural-only

    "He couldn't bring himself to eat the remains of the chicken dinner."

Verb
  1. 1
    third-person singular simple present indicative of remain form-of, indicative, present, singular, third-person

    "We'll go ahead, while she remains here."
